Advantages of single frequency lasers
Single frequency lasers deliver ultra-narrow laser linewidths (< 0.5 MHz), minimal intensity noise (< 0.1% RMS), and a pristine, diffraction-limited TEM00 beam.
The Skylark Lasers NX series of single frequency lasers are built using a unique optical architecture. They are hermetically sealed, guaranteeing long-lasting, ultra-stable operation and high performance in demanding applications.
Ideal for advanced laboratory research, they are suited for analytical instrumentation for applications like Raman spectroscopy, interferometry, holography, and quantum technology development - where precision, stability, and spectral purity are vital.
